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•Healthy undergraduate medical students of the institute of either sex in the
- •age group 18 to 25 years who are willing to participate in the study. •
Exclusion Criteria
- •Students with diagnosed psychiatric illness or any prescribed medication for psychiatric disorder will be excluded.
- •Subjects otherwise healthy but returning incomplete questionnaires will be excluded too.
